Pros

5 years ago, and prior: Pretty good company. Now: Who let in Bank of America?!

Cons

5 years ago: Pay could be better, benefits could be better, but not a bad place to work. Now: What happened?! SSFCU is supposed to be NON PROFIT, but you sure could have fooled me. Go into any branch and pay attention to the rep trying to squeeze every once of sales opportunities from each and every single member. The member was so valued at one point. But despite the hoopla people are making about members are a priority, members needs are no longer first. Sales are first. They are disguising sales as service. But every can see through it, and more importantly, they can feel it! Ladies and gentlemen: I present to you Bank of America Jr. Congratulations on your newborn baby, lets hope it doesn't become the monster the parent was.

Pros

It's a great introduction to financial institutions and the company has a strong message and desire to help employees as well as members. Amazing 401k and very good health benefits, and assistance with mortgage after 3 years employment. Also finally getting new teller tech after 18 years.

Cons

Downside is that the new CEO is extremely sales driven and the local management is 10-20 + years tenured. Several managers are often aggressive or unprofessional, play favorites, and constantly micromanage and document everything. The environment feels harsh and you will be put on improvement plans for any mistakes or not meeting high sales goals. AI is being heavily integrated and PTO is now accrual based and not given at the beginning of the year anymore to avoid paying out PTO to terminated employees. You can’t transfer to other departments unless you live in Texas and work for years there.
